Output 85902ea56ab966d1e8e8ec7934c31acb86b415f820d6796a2be9cef97e399107:5

value
130695733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9202c2ae9674ebcb51149dcd03c50429e1faa70d OP_EQUAL
address
3F13tMPGi5yD4arEw6gGUpthwPNGV4K9Xr
transaction
85902ea56ab966d1e8e8ec7934c31acb86b415f820d6796a2be9cef97e399107
spent
true